7-(4,6-Dimethoxypyrimidinyl)oxy- and -thiophthalides as novel herbicides : Part 1. CGA 279 233 : a new grass-killer for rice
2001
A series of novel types of 7-(4,6-dimethoxypyrimidin-2-yl)oxy - and -thio-3-methyl-1 (3H)-isobenzofuranones were discovered at Dr R Maag AG. From the thio-isobenzofuranyl series, CGA 279 233—BSI-proposed common name pyriftalid—was chosen for further development as a grass herbicide for use in rice. General synthetic approaches to these new phthalic acid-derived compounds are given, with emphasis on the synthesis of pyriftalid and its physico-chemical behaviour.
